Getting Started with Notion

Before diving into the organizational strategies, it’s essential to familiarize yourself with Notion’s interface and features. Here’s a brief overview:

  • Workspace: This is your main hub where all your pages and databases reside.
  • Pages: These are individual sections or documents for specific topics or projects.
  • Blocks: Everything in Notion is a block—text, images, tables, and databases can all be manipulated as discrete units.
  • Templates: Notion offers a wide variety of templates to help you start quickly.

Creating Your First Page

To create a new page, click the ‘+ New Page’ button in your workspace. You can choose to start from scratch or select a template that suits your needs. Consider the following options:

  1. Personal Dashboard: A centralized place for your personal tasks, goals, and projects.
  2. Project Management Board: A Kanban-style board to manage tasks in progress, completed tasks, and upcoming tasks.
  3. Reading List: Maintain a list of books or articles you wish to read with notes and completion statuses.

2. Task Management

Effective task management is at the heart of any organizational system. Create a dedicated tasks database using the following attributes:

  • Task Name: The name of the task.
  • Due Date: When the task needs to be completed.
  • Status: Options like ‘To Do’, ‘In Progress’, and ‘Completed’.
  • Priority: A simple ranking system (e.g., High, Medium, Low).

Utilize views such as:

  1. Kanban Board: Visually track tasks through different statuses.
  2. Calendar View: See tasks in a chronological format.

3. Knowledge Management

Notion is fantastic for creating a personal knowledge base. You can create linked databases for different topics, such as:

  • Notes: Capture insights from meetings or lectures.
  • Research: Store articles, papers, and summaries on various subjects.
  • Learning Plans: Keep track of skills you want to learn and resources to do so.

Maintaining Your Organization System

An organization system is only as effective as your commitment to maintaining it. Here are a few tips:

  • Regular Reviews: Schedule weekly check-ins to assess your tasks and goals.
  • Keep it Simple: Don’t overcomplicate your systems; simplicity often leads to better effectiveness.
  • Adjust as Needed: Be flexible and willing to make changes when something isn’t working.

Creating a Routine

Incorporate the use of Notion into your daily routine to reinforce the habit:

  1. Start your day by reviewing tasks and setting priorities.
  2. Update progress on tasks throughout the day.
  3. End the day by reflecting on what was accomplished and what needs to be carried forward.
